Imagine a world where the dress chose you—that was the fantasy premise at last night’s screening of Alice Rohrwacher’s “De Djess,” the latest in Miu Miu’s series of all female-directed Women’s Tales shorts. The dress in mind? A fifties-influenced, bead-embellished ivory jewel drawn from Miuccia Prada’s John Waters–inspired, so-decadent-it’s-trashy spring 2015 collection. This piece, it turned out, was the star of the film, which was screened to a crowd including the likes of Maggie Gyllenhaal, Willem Dafoe, Virginie Mouzat, Michelle Harper, and more within the winding five stories of Sutton Place’s private River Club last night.
